Venoct (Japanese: オロチ Orochi) is an Rank S, Lightning-attribute Yo-kai of the Slippery tribe introduced in Yo-kai Watch. From Yo-kai Watch: Ukiukipedia Kiwami to Yo-kai Watch: Ukiukipedia Gakuen Y, and in Yo-kai Watch 4, he's the part of the Onechanside Yo-kai of the Goriki tribe.

In Yo-kai Watch 2, Venoct is one of the Yo-kai required to unlock Poofessor.

Biology[]

Appearance[]

Venoct has snow white skin and golden eyes, with long and dark teal hair that covers most of his face, tied into a ponytail with a sky blue ponytail holder. He wears a dark purple kimono with a black overcoat hanging off his waist, tied with a white belt. He wears black shin covers and fingerless gloves, as well as straw sandals. Around his neck's an azure, wisp-like scarf with tails resembling dragon heads. He is 140 cm tall (About 55 inches).

Personality[]

Extremely serious, stern and stoic, Venoct's a fighter through and through, and doesn't make friends easily. However he is also extremely honorable and would never break the few bonds he's forged. Even his initial interaction with others is cold and standoffish, with him rebuffing any ideas that he might be their ally. He also seems to not like being a Yo-kai due to his tone of voice. Venoct is staunchly loyal to the late ruler of Springdale's Yo-kai World, Ancient Enma, and he agreed to protect his son, Lucas, by erasing his memories and blending him into the human world.

While he shares some traits with his counterpart Kyubi, he lacks that Yo-kai's arrogance and manipulative nature. His personality is left largely intact in the transition to the anime, where his serious disposition makes him seem very intense when compared to the more comical characters in the show.

In the anime, during his quest for revenge, Venoct initially annoyed Nate and Whisper with his constant appearances.

Yo-kai Watch 2[]

Besides assisting the heroes alongside Kyubi to stop McKraken's forces in the first game, in Yo-kai Watch 2, Venoct is the second in command in the Bonies army, the same position as Kyubi in the Fleshies army.

In Yo-kai Watch 2, talk to a boy in the book store to activate the Bony Spirits exclusive quest "Enma and the Serpent"

  1. Talk to an old man near the grave behind the Shoten Temple.
  2. Talk to Flushback in the Yo-kai World.
  3. Talk to Venoct on Mount Wildwood Summit at night.
  4. Fight Venoct to finish the quest.
  5. Wait 1 day after the Quest to battle him again to befriend him if possible.

Etymology[]

  • His English name, 'Venoct', is a combination of venom, another word for a deadly poison or toxin, and oct, a prefix meaning "eight".
  • His Japanese name 'Orochi' is taken from Yamata no Orochi.
  • His Italian name "Velenotto" is a combination of veleno (poison) and otto (eight).

Origin[]

Venoct is based on Yamata-no-Orochi , the eight-headed serpent that terrorized Japan during the age of mythology, and demanded young maidens in sacrifice. The god Susanoo, who had been exiled after a dramatic fall-out with his sister, the sun goddess Amaterasu, rescues the princess Kushinada before she's sacrificed to Orochi, defeating him by offering him eight barrels of sake then cutting off the heads of the inebriated beast one by one. After he slayed the snake, he cut off its heads and tails. As he cut the fourth tail, his sword broke and he discovered the legendary sword Kusanagi-no-Tsurugi within the serpent's corpse. Susanoo gave the sword to Amaterasu's to earn forgiveness, and he was once again allowed into the realm of the gods. The sword became one of the three Imperial Regalia of Japan, along with the mirror Yata no Kagami and the jewel Yasakani no Magatama.

Venoct's appearance might also be based on Orochimaru, the former pupil and rival of the legendary ninja Jiraiya (see Ogama#Origin), and master of snake-summoning magic.

Trivia[]

VenoctModelSheet

Venoct's model sheet, where it has a visible mouth.

  • Venoct has a hidden mouth that is rarely seen, except for sixth chapter of the Enma no Kyūjitsu manga, where one of Jerry's flashbacks in the anime series depict Venoct with a visible mouth rather than being hidden.
    • According to Venoct's model sheet for the Yo-kai Watch anime series, he has a mouth where it's noted that it shouldn't ever be seen.
  • In the Japanese version of the Yo-kai Watch video game, Venoct uses the assertive, masculine ore first pronoun but, in the second game he instead uses the more polite/neutral watashi.
  • In the English version of the game and the English dub of the anime, Venoct and Nate share the same voice actor (Johnny Yong Bosch).
  • In M03, Venoct is shown to be able to evolve into Illuminoct despite this not being possible in the games, Even in EP186 it appears alongside Shadow Venoct, Venoctobot and Illuminoct.
